But what is the matter with the unbelievers who are hurrying towards you 36 On the right and on the left, in groups? 37 Doth every man among them hope to enter the Garden of Delight? 38 No! Indeed, We have created them from that which they know. 39 But nay! I swear by the Lord of the rising-places and the setting-places of the planets that We verily are Able 40 to replace them with others better than them: nothing can prevent Us from doing this, 41 Therefore leave them alone to go on with the false discourses and to sport until they come face to face with that day of theirs with which they are threatened; 42 The Day whereon they will issue from their sepulchres in sudden haste as if they were rushing to a goal-post (fixed for them),- 43 With eyes aghast, abasement stupefying them: Such is the Day which they are promised. 44
Almighty Allah's Truth.
End of Surah: The Heights (Al-Ma'aarej). Sent down in Mecca after Incontestable (Al-Haaqqah) before The News (Al-Naba')
